人工智能大模型的开发是一项复杂而精细的工作,需要多方面的知识和技能。下面将详细介绍人工智能大模型的开发过程:
1. 数据准备:在开发人工智能大模型之前,需要收集和整理大量的数据。这些数据可以来自公开的数据集、合作伙伴或通过爬虫技术获取。数据的准备包括清洗、标注和预处理等步骤,以确保数据的质量和一致性。
2. 模型设计:根据问题的性质和需求,选择合适的模型框架和技术。常见的人工智能大模型框架包括深度学习、自然语言处理、计算机视觉等。在模型设计阶段,需要确定模型的结构、参数设置和优化方法等。
3. 训练和优化:使用准备好的数据对模型进行训练。训练过程中,需要不断调整模型的参数和结构,以提高模型的性能和泛化能力。同时,还需要进行模型验证和评估,确保模型的稳定性和可靠性。
4. 模型调优:在训练过程中,可能会出现过拟合、欠拟合等问题。为了解决这些问题,需要进行模型调优,包括正则化、Dropout等技术的应用,以及超参数的选择和调整等。
5. 模型部署:将训练好的模型部署到实际应用场景中,例如语音识别、图像识别、推荐系统等。在部署过程中,需要考虑模型的可扩展性、稳定性和性能等因素,以确保模型在实际环境中能够稳定运行。
6. 持续优化:人工智能大模型的开发是一个持续的过程,需要不断地收集新的数据、更新算法和技术,以适应不断变化的需求和环境。此外,还需要关注行业动态和技术发展趋势,以便及时调整模型的方向和策略。
总之,人工智能大模型的开发是一个综合性的工作,需要跨学科的知识和技术。从数据准备到模型训练、优化、部署和持续优化,每一步都需要精心设计和执行。只有不断学习和改进,才能开发出高质量的人工智能大模型,为实际应用提供强大的支持。